What is zinc oxide?

Zinc oxide is the ingredient that protects your skin from the sun in most mineral sunscreens. It’s a mineral that naturally occurs in nature, but it can also be produced synthetically. Thanks to its many active properties, zinc oxide is a popular ingredient in both cosmetics and pharmaceuticals.

As a broad-spectrum UV filter, zinc oxide sunscreen protects against both UVA and UVB radiation. This helps to prevent sunburn and slows down signs of skin aging.

What does zinc oxide do on your skin?

Zinc oxide does more than just protect you from the sun. It also has a mild drying effect and is widely used in pharmaceutical products such as:

  • Sunscreen – Zinc oxide particles sit on top of the skin and act as a physical UV filter. This is the active ingredient in most mineral sunscreens.

  • Cold sores – Zinc oxide helps dry out the skin and reduces pain and itching. It’s often sold as zinc ointment, paste, or cream in pharmacies.

  • Eczema – In cases of weeping eczema, zinc oxide ointments help to dry and soothe the skin and reduce itching. Your doctor may prescribe this.

Tip: Dealing with dry skin?
Zinc oxide can have a drying effect. If your skin feels a bit tight after using mineral sunscreen, follow up with a gentle, hydrating body lotion or day cream. That way you can enjoy the sunshine and keep your skin glowing!

How does mineral sunscreen work?

Environmentally friendly:
When chemical sunscreens wash off into the water, they release harmful substances. But when zinc oxide sunscreen enters the water, it slowly dissolves and turns into zinc ions – a natural component already found in the ocean.

Although some studies suggest that a higher concentration of zinc ions could affect marine life, the environmental impact of zinc oxide sunscreen is likely minimal compared to pollution from industrial sources. Right now, it’s considered one of the safest and most eco-conscious options available.

Better for your skin too:
Our mineral sunscreen contains non-nano zinc oxide particles, which means they are too large to penetrate the skin. Instead, they stay on the surface and reflect both UVA and UVB rays. That makes them a great option for sensitive skin and daily protection.

Why choose mineral sunscreen?

Zinc oxide sunscreen offers several benefits compared to traditional (chemical) sunscreens:

  • Traditional sunscreens absorb UV rays and convert them into heat, while zinc oxide reflects them.

  • Zinc oxide provides immediate protection – no need to wait after applying.

  • The particles stay on your skin, making irritation less likely.

  • Zinc oxide is reef-safe, meaning it’s safe to use even in tropical waters.
